Understanding Label Printers

Label printers are specialized printers designed to produce labels for a variety of purposes. Whether you need labels for shipping, inventory management, or branding, a good label printer can make the process swift and accurate.

Types of Label Printers

There are several types of label printers available on the market, each suited for different business needs:

  • Direct Thermal Printers: These printers create images by heating special heat-sensitive labels. They are ideal for short-term labels such as shipping and shelf labels.
  • Thermal Transfer Printers: These printers use a thermal ribbon to transfer ink onto labels. They are known for producing more durable and long-lasting labels, making them suitable for product labeling.
  • Inkjet Label Printers: Inkjet printers can print high-quality color labels but may not be as fast as thermal printers. They are perfect for businesses needing more colorful designs.
  • Laser Label Printers: These are high-speed printers that use laser technology to produce sharp and long-lasting labels. They are suitable for high-volume printing.
  • Portable Label Printers: These compact devices are perfect for on-the-go label printing, often connected via Bluetooth to smartphones or tablets.

Key Features to Look For When You Buy a Label Printer

When deciding to buy label printer, consider the following features to ensure it meets your business requirements:

Print Quality

The resolution of the printer is crucial. A higher DPI (dots per inch) will ensure that your labels are sharp and professional. For example, a resolution of 300 DPI is typically sufficient for most labels, while barcodes and intricate designs might require higher resolutions.

Print Speed

If your business requires high-volume printing, consider the printer's speed, measured in inches per second (IPS). A faster printer will save you valuable time and increase productivity.

Label Compatibility

Ensure the printer can handle the type and size of labels you need. Some printers are versatile and can print on various label sizes and materials, while others are more limited.

Connectivity Options

Modern label printers offer various connectivity options such as USB, Ethernet, Wi-Fi, and Bluetooth. Choose a printer that integrates easily into your existing setup.

Durability and Reliability

If your printer will be used in a busy environment, look for a model that is known for its ruggedness and reliability. Read reviews and check warranties to make an informed choice.

Common Uses of Label Printers in Business

Label printers serve a multitude of purposes across various industries. Here are some common applications:

  • Shipping and Mailing: Create clear and professional shipping labels that facilitate the delivery process.
  • Inventory Management: Track stock levels and product information with easy-to-scannable barcode labels.
  • Product Labeling: Design eye-catching labels for products that showcase branding and pricing effectively.
  • Office Organization: Use labels for filing systems, file folders, and other organizational tasks to enhance workplace efficiency.
  • Laboratory and Medical Uses: Accurately label samples and pharmaceutical items to ensure compliance and avoid errors.

Understanding the Cost of Label Printers

The price of label printers varies based on several factors including brand, features, and technology. Here’s what to consider:

Initial Purchase Cost

The initial outlay for a printer encompasses not just the cost of the printer itself but also essential supplies such as labels and ink or thermal ribbons.

Operational Costs

Think about the cost involved in consumables like labels and printing supplies over time. Thermal printers typically have lower operating costs compared to inkjet printers due to lesser consumables.

Repair and Maintenance Costs

Consider potential repair and maintenance needs. Invest in a model with a good warranty and customer support to reduce unexpected expenditures.
